GitHub поддерживает несколько методов двухфакторной аутентификации (2FA), включая одноразовый пароль на основе времени (TOTP) и аутентификацию на основе push-уведомлений.
Общий процесс проверки двухфакторной аутентификации (2FA):
- Откройте приложение TOTP-аутентификатора.: это может быть Google Authenticator、Microsoft Authenticator、1Password Или любое другое приложение, в котором вы настроили двухфакторную аутентификацию.
- найти аккаунт: В приложении TOTP найдите учетную запись, для которой вам нужен код подтверждения. Обычно это указывается по названию веб-сайта или службы.
- Посмотреть код: Приложение отобразит 6-8-значный код, который меняется каждые 30 секунд. Это ваш TOTP-код.
- Введите код на сайте или сервисе: Быстро вернитесь на веб-сайт или службу, к которой вы пытаетесь получить доступ, и введите этот код при появлении соответствующего запроса. Помните, что эти коды чувствительны ко времени, поэтому вам следует работать быстро.
- Завершите процесс входа в систему: После ввода кода выполните все остальные необходимые действия для завершения Авторизации.
Если вы используете расширение браузера для TOTP, процесс аналогичен. Щелкните значок расширения в браузере, найдите нужную учетную запись и используйте предоставленный ею код.
Помните, что важно защитить ваше приложение TOTP или расширение браузера, поскольку это важная часть защиты ваших онлайн-аккаунтов.
1Password и Microsoft Authenticator — это инструменты, поддерживающие TOTP, поэтому их можно использовать с функцией двухэтапной проверки GitHub.
1. Поддержка TOTP:
- 1Password: 1Password может генерировать TOTP. Проверочный файл опубликован на GitHub. код. Когда пользователи включают 2FA на GitHub, они сканируют или вручную вводят ключ TOTP, сгенерированный в 1Password, чтобы связать свою учетную запись GitHub с 1Password. После этого пользователям необходимо будет вводить динамический Проверочный файл, сгенерированный 1Password, каждый раз, когда они Авторизуются GitHub. код。
- Microsoft Authenticator: Аналогично, Майкрософт Аутентификатор также поддерживает создание TOTP-Проверочного. код. После того, как пользователи включили 2FA на GitHub, Microsoft Аутентификатор связывается с GitHub путем сканирования или ручного ввода ключа TOTP. Впоследствии каждый раз, когда Авторизуетесь на GitHub, пользователю необходимо предоставить Microsoft Динамический Проверочный, созданный Authenticator код。
2. Push-уведомление:
- Microsoft Authenticator: Для приложений, поддерживающих толкать уведомления, Microsoft Аутентификатор также предоставляет более удобный метод проверки. Когда пользователи пытаются Авторизоваться GitHub, Microsoft Authenticator может отправлять пользователю толкать уведомление,Пользователю необходимо только подтвердить уведомление для завершения аутентификации.
Подводя итог, можно сказать, что двухэтапная система проверки GitHub является гибкой и совместимой с несколькими инструментами генерации TOTP, включая 1Password и Microsoft Authenticator. Пользователи могут выбрать подходящий метод двухэтапной проверки на основе личных предпочтений и совместимости устройства.